A Wine With a Sense of Place

The fruit for Bin 707 is always sourced from Penfolds’ most prized Cabernet vineyards, and in 2021 that meant a selection of outstanding parcels from regions like Coonawarra, Barossa Valley, and Wrattonbully. Each of these areas brings something different to the table—deep, dark fruit from the Barossa; lifted aromatics and structured tannins from Coonawarra; and bright, energetic flavors from Wrattonbully. The magic of Bin 707 lies in how these components are woven together into one seamless expression.

The 2021 growing season was kind to Cabernet, offering balanced temperatures and an even ripening pattern. The result was fruit with exceptional purity and depth, giving the winemaking team the raw materials they needed for a powerful but polished release.

Crafted With Intention

Penfolds treats Bin 707 with the same level of precision it brings to its top-tier wines. It’s always 100% Cabernet Sauvignon, always bold, and always built to age. The 2021 vintage spent its maturation period in new American oak hogsheads—a distinctive choice that leaves its signature on the wine, adding layers of toasted spice, vanilla, chocolate, and warm, savory complexity.

The goal is simple: create a Cabernet that’s unapologetically rich and Australian in character, yet refined enough to stand shoulder to shoulder with the world’s great cellar-worthy wines.

Tasting

The 2021 Bin 707 greets you with deep, vibrant aromas—think blackcurrant, mulberry, ripe blackberry, and a swirl of cassis. As it opens, more exotic notes emerge: hints of Moroccan spice, dark chocolate, toasted grain, and even a touch of brandy snap sweetness. It’s the kind of nose that rewards patience, evolving gradually as the wine breathes.

On the palate, the wine is full bodied, layered, and commanding. Plush waves of dark fruit lead the way, supported by flavors of black fig, cocoa, licorice, and raspberry coulis. The tannins are firm but beautifully polished, giving the wine a sculpted frame that promises decades of graceful aging. There’s a creamy, luxurious texture through the mid-palate and a finish that lingers long after the last sip.
